#f72c68 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f72c68 is composed of 96.9% red, 17.3%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.2%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 342.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 57.1%. #f72c68 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ff58d0 with #ef0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

Shades and Tints of #f72c68

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100105 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f72c68

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929191 is the less saturated color, while #f72c68 is the most saturated one.
